WebOptical radiation is a type of electromagnetic (EM) radiation. As with other types of EM radiation, optical radiation is defined according to the wavelength of the energy that it emits. For radiation to be considered optical radiation, it must have a wavelength between 100 nanometers (nm) and 1 millimeter (mm, equivalent to 1,000,000 nm). WebUltraviolet ( UV) radiation is the highest-energy form of optical radiation and includes the wavelengths from 100 to 400 nanometres ( nm ). The term "visible light" refers to the region of the electromagnetic spectrum that humans can see. These wavelengths range from 400 to 780 nm. Some animals can see a wider region of the spectrum than humans.
